How does Monroe, GA compare to Dublin, GA? Monroe has a population of 15,336 with a median household income of $43,991, while Dublin has 16,023 residents and a median income of $40,417. Below you'll find a detailed breakdown of demographics, economy, and housing for both cities.
| Metric | Monroe, GA | Dublin, GA |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Population | 15,336 | 16,023 | -4.3% |
| Median Age | 29.5 | 34.3 | -14.0% |
| Foreign Born % | 4.1% | 2.7% | +51.9% |
| Metric | Monroe | Dublin |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Median Income | $43,991 | $40,417 | +8.8% |
| Unemployment | 12.2% | 8.9% | +37.1% |
| Poverty Rate | 38.7% | 35.1% | +10.3% |
| Bachelor's+ | 17.3% | 22.7% | -23.8% |
| Metric | Monroe | Dublin |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Home Value | $222,000 | $173,500 | +28.0% |
| Median Rent | $1118/mo | $752/mo | +48.7% |
| Housing Units | 5,131 | 6,717 | -23.6% |
